Backlink (inbound link)

A backlink is a link placed on a third-party site pointing to yours. Search engines treat it as a vote of confidence, weighted by the referring site’s authority and its thematic closeness to your content.

In practice

Ten links from established bodies in your sector outweigh a thousand links from anonymous directories. Google penalizes link buying and artificial networks; durable links are earned with content that press or peers genuinely want to cite — original studies, data sets, free tools. The shortcut always costs more in the long run.
